About This Item
Toronto, Ontario: Stoddart Publishing, 1998. Book. Very Good. Hardcover. Third Printing. Signed by Eddie Shack (#23) and by [? #22] on the half title page with no inscription; a bit of edge wear to boards and dust jacket; otherwise a solid, clean copy with no marking or underlining; collectible condition; illustrated with black and white photographs.
